Your subscriber base will grow by itself. Use A/B testing to test subject line variations. For a single email, split your mailing list in half randomly, with each half receiving messages that have different subjects. This allows you to determine which subject lines are successful and which ones are simply ignored. Remain consistent at all times. Remember that more and more people are reading their email with a mobile device, like a smartphone. Such devices have just a fraction of the resolution of a standard computer monitor, so your messages will look quite different. Find out how your messages look on these devices, and make any changes necessary to make them easy to read on small phone screens. Include lots of useful information in all your messages. Some ISPs may even consider blacklisting you, which can have a negative impact on your business. Don't send emails that require images to present information. Many modern email clients - web-based ones, especially - will not display images automatically. This might mean that your emails are unpleasant to look out, or can't be read at all, because of the images that they contain. Therefore, it is important that all relevant information be given using text only; any images you wish to include should have descriptive tags.
